Veeram Pura Population - Jodhpur, Rajasthan

Veeram Pura is a medium size village located in Shergarh Tehsil of Jodhpur district, Rajasthan with total 61 families residing. The Veeram Pura village has population of 400 of which 207 are males while 193 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Veeram Pura village population of children with age 0-6 is 63 which makes up 15.75 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Veeram Pura village is 932 which is higher than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Veeram Pura as per census is 909, higher than Rajasthan average of 888.

Veeram Pura village has higher liter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Veeram Pura village was 71.22 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Veeram Pura Male literacy stands at 85.06 % while female literacy rate was 56.44 %.

Caste Factor

There is no population of Schedule Caste (SC) and Schedule Tribe(ST) in Veeram Pura village of Jodhpur district.

Work Profile

In Veeram Pura village out of total population, 240 were engaged in work activities. 99.58 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 0.42 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 240 workers engaged in Main Work, 230 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ourer.
